This refers to the inspection ecnducted by Mr. G. T.'Gibson of this;.
office on.0ctober 26 and 27, 1976,Lof' activities at the Big Rock Point-
'
Nuclear Plant authorized by NRC Operating License No. DPR-6 and- to the
discuss ton of. our fiodings with Mr. C. fJ. Hartman and members of b is -
staff at the conclusion of the ' inspection.
The enclosed copy of our inspection report iderit$ fies areas examined '
during the inspection. Within these. areas,- the inspection consisted of
a selective examination of. procedures'and. representative-records,
observations, and interviews with personnel.
(
No items of noncompliance with NRC' requirements vere -identified during-
the course of this-inspection. Ue have noted, however, - your performar.cc
in the Confirmatory Mcasurecents progran hes yielded only 64% acceptable
comparisons for this inspection and-only 54%.overall since 1974.
Future unacceptable comparisons will require remedial action.
